The making of 10th Sarkin Gobir Ilorin by Umar Bayo Abdulwahab

Date: 2025-03-14

Recently the Emir of Ilorin Alhaji Ibrahim-Sulu-Gambari turbaned the head of the Gobir clan in Ilorin whose ancestry journey can be traced to the historic kingdom of Gobir in the present-day Sokoto state. In this piece, UMAR BAYO ABDULWAHAB captures the moment and the historical background of Gobir Kingdom.

Gambari, the heart of Ilorin Emirate in Ilorin-east local government area of Kwara state was agog just recently as the Emir officially turbaned a renowned pharmacist and philanthropist, Alhaji Yakubu Gobir as 10th Sarkin Gobir of Ilorin.

From Gambari to Oja-Oba where the palace of Ilorin Emir is situated, residents of the ancient Islamic city witnessed a display of royalty, culture, colours and class as the sons and daughters of the community proudly came out to honour an Illustrious son who was officially turbaned as the 10th Sarkin Gobir of Ilorin Emirate.

The emir appointed Yakubu Gobir the 10th Sarkin Gobir of Ilorin following the demise of his cousin, captain Alhaji Muhammad Ahmad Yusuf-Gobir in October 2024 who had held the tittle until his demise.

The title of Sarkin Gobir is one of the most respected hereditary traditional titles in Ilorin with a very rich and exciting history.

The Emir, while performing the turbaning ceremony at his place, urged the new titleholder who also holds the title of Madawaki of Ilorin, to uphold the virtues of selflessness, integrity and community service that earned him the prestigious title.

“Alhaji Yakubu Gobir is a true son of Ilorin and I am proud of him. He has consistently demonstrated a commitment to community development and the upliftment of the less privileged. With this new role, you must unite the Gobir clan and continue to promote the rich cultural heritage of this Emirate. May Almighty Allah guide you aright,” the royal father said.

Royal procession

Following the turbaning ceremony, Alhaji Yakubu Gobir rode on horseback in a grand procession to the Emir's Palace, accompanied by a large crowd of well-wishers. The colorful display of Ilorin's rich cultural heritage reaffirmed the deep-rooted traditions of the emirate.

Going spiritual

Later in the day, a prayer session was organised in honor of the new Sarkin Gobir at his family compound. The prayer service was led by the Chief Imam of Gambari, Sheikh Suleiman AbdulAzeez, who prayed for wisdom, strength, and divine guidance for the new traditional leader as he assumes his new role.

Responsibility

As the new Sarkin Gobir, Alhaji Yakubu Gobir is tasked with the responsibility of fostering unity within the Gobir clan and advancing the Emirate's cultural legacy.

The genesis

The title of Sarkin Gobir is one of the most respected hereditary traditional titles in Ilorin with a very rich and exciting history.

Blueprint checks revealed that Sarkin Gobir is one of the sub-chiefs under the headship of the Balogun Gambari of Ilorin.

The national secretary of Ilorin Emirate Descendants Progressive Union (IEDPU), Alhaji Imam Abubakar, said the holder of the title of Sarkin Gobir is the traditional head of the entire Gobir family. He is also the head of the Gobir clan as well as all indigenes and residents of Ilorin whose ancestry can be traced to the historic kingdom of Gobir in the present-day Sokoto state.

“Gobir itself is a popular tribe whose existence and popularity predated the historic Jihad of Shaykh Usman Danfodiyo, the founder of Sokoto Caliphate. Its history dates back to the pre-Islamic Arabia and through migration across the mediterranean ocean to the present-day Niger Republic.

“The group, through wars and migration, eventually found its way into Nigeria and especially in the contemporary Sokoto state from where the ancestors of the new Sarkin Gobir of Ilorin came down to Ilorin.

“The people of Gobir, who are called Gobirawa, are said to be among the first sets of Hausa-speaking groups known to the Yoruba. They are courageous and industrious people and are also fearless warriors.

“Many of them led by Sarkin Gobir Soba (who was a direct descendant of Sarkin Gobir Yunfa and Sarkin Gobir Nafata) as a result of the rampaging effects of the Jihad launched by Shaykh Usman Danfodiyo, migrated down south. They served as farmers, soldiers and hunters across Yorubaland and Nupeland and eventually found a home in Ilorin”.

“The Gobirawa continued to thrive in Ilorin, leading to a close relationship with members of other groups.”
